commit | 41e2d6f933b1f5e931618a5e2e5a2b8e4dd54354 | [log] [tgz] |
---|---|---|
author | Manikandan Mohan <manikand@codeaurora.org> | Mon Apr 10 16:17:39 2017 +0530 |
committer | Sandeep Puligilla <spuligil@codeaurora.org> | Tue Apr 11 00:16:59 2017 -0700 |
tree | 3f8d4c929d7680fcc2aaff6e6d4e5a69ac33d180 | |
parent | 85d8f9b5d7e5ce152b479449921371b5963baa19 [diff] |
qcacld-3.0: Fix for memory leaks in multiple functions 1) Fix for memory leaks lim management frame registration queue by unconditionally removing all nodes from queue and releasing the node pointer. This need to be done for FTM mode also. 2) Free u_mac_post_ctrl_msgu_mac_post_ctrl_msg in the error cases. 3) In wma_tx_packet(), free tx_frame memory in error cases. Change-Id: Idbae6b2666d38d0f130d0115e5a05387c0b63c31 CRs-fixed: 2027588